MSN Messenger
How do I get rid of this overly cumbersome latest version and resort to the older much simpler version?
I see nothing in the delete programs section to do this. No mention of MSN. I do see Windows live but am reluctant to delete that without some expert advice. Thanks for your thoughts. Jim B

you want to uninstall Windows Live Messenger, you can do this from Add/Remove programs in the control panel. You can install an older version of Messenger if you want from this site
http://www.oldversion.com/MSN-Messenger.html I will warn you that older versions of Messenger have a number of security vulnerabilities that have been patched in newer versions. |

I despised the new version of messenger, it was bloated and horrible on my XP machines and caused freezes on my W7 machine. So I uninstalled it by uninstalling Windows Live and installed an earlier version from filehippo.com.
Excellent thought I, not so great thought Messenger and refused to log me into the system unless I upgraded to the latest version.... I even tried the latest of the old versions and I couldn't log in.
